I own two large power conditioners. The 88lb Furman sits halfway between the amplifier (which is between the speakers) and the audio rack (which is near my seating) I used to use that PC for the amp too, not anymore, but too lazy to move it. It sits on the floor up on spikes. The other PS Audio P-600 is behind the audio rack..One comment on placing something ON TOP of a power conditioner... If it has a big transformer.. I would say you should at least have an extra inch of space added between the top and any component over it.
Another consideration is realize plugging and unplugging power cords.. plus if you use aftermarket thick and unwieldy cords.. Some racks block acess.. You make need to just put the power conditioner on the floor where you can allow power cords to fit without a hassle.Also if the conditioner is off the floor.. then the weight of aftermarket power cords and them pulling out of the AC outlets is a big PITA too. So all in all the floor is the best overall place for one. Maybe up on spikes to keep the bottom vents clear of the carpet.
